From: Human- and Mouse-Inducible Nitric Oxide Synthase Promoters Require Activation of Phosphatidylcholine-Specific Phospholipase C and NF-κB

Fig. 5

D609 inhibits expression of human and mouse type II NOS protein

D609 (50 µg/ml) was added to cell RAW 264.7 or human A549 cell cultures 30 min before they were activated as described for Fig. 1. Following incubation for 24 hr, cells were washed with PBS and lysed in 2% SDS; the protein concentration was determined with a DC Protein Assay kit (Bio-Rad). An aliquot of 50 µg of each sample was electrophoresed through a 10% SDS-PAGE gel and transferred to a nitrocellulose membrane. The presence of a 130-kDa type II NOS band was detected with rabbit anti-type II NOS antibodies (Santa Cruz Biotechnology, Inc.). For both human (hiNOS) and mouse (miNOS) cell lysates, unactivated (lane 1) cells were compared with activated (lane 2), and activated, D609-treated cells (lane 3).
